Understanding Air Quality Management in Equine Transport and Stabling
Effective air quality management in horse transport and stabling environments involves understanding the primary contaminants, their health impacts, and the filtration technologies that address each. Haymaking dust, mould spores, ammonia from soiled bedding, and pollen represent the primary airborne challenges in UK equestrian settings, each requiring different filtration approaches for optimal removal.
HEPA filtration captures particles as small as 0.3 microns, effectively removing dust, pollen, and mould spores common in British hay and straw
Activated carbon filters absorb gaseous contaminants including ammonia and odours generated during transport or from soiled bedding materials
Pre-filtration stages extend the operational life of HEPA filters by removing larger particles, reducing maintenance frequency during winter months
Noise levels below 65 decibels are considered acceptable for equine transport to minimise stress-related behaviours during journeys
Portable systems offer flexibility for multiple locations, whilst permanent installations provide comprehensive yard-wide air quality management
Filter replacement intervals typically range from 3-6 months depending on usage intensity and environmental dust levels in your region
Proper ventilation balance ensures adequate air circulation without creating drafts that may compromise thermoregulation during transport
